How much do orioles stadium jobs pay per hour?

As of Sep 8, 2026, the average hourly pay for orioles stadium in the United States is $19.14,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$14.42 and $20.19 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are jobs at Orioles Stadium?

Jobs at Orioles Stadium cover a wide range of roles, including positions in guest services, concessions, security, maintenance, event operations, ticket sales, and groundskeeping. These roles are essential for ensuring that games and events run smoothly and that fans have a positive experience. Opportunities are available for both seasonal and full-time employment, making it an attractive workplace for those interested in sports, hospitality, or event management. Employees often enjoy a dynamic work environment and the chance to be part of the excitement at a Major League Baseball venue.

What are the typical responsibilities for staff working at Orioles Stadium on game days?

On game days at Orioles Stadium, staff members may be assigned to a variety of roles, including ticketing, guest services, concessions, security, or maintenance. Responsibilities often involve interacting with fans, ensuring safety protocols are followed, and keeping the stadium clean and welcoming. Teamwork is essential, as staff coordinate closely with colleagues and supervisors to provide a seamless experience for attendees. Flexibility and strong communication skills are important, as the pace can be fast and priorities may shift quickly depending on stadium needs.

The University of Maryland Division of Urology Seeks a Reconstructive Surgeon

The Division of Urology at the University of Maryland School of Medicine is recruiting for a BC/BE urologist interested in reconstructive urology. Applicants should be qualified to be appointed at the rank of Assistant Professor or Associate Professor. Responsibilities will include clinical care of urology patients, education of students and residents and participation in research programs. Practice opportunities are available at the University of Maryland Medical Center, University of Maryland Midtown Campus, Veterans’ Affairs Maryland Health Care System (Baltimore) and other system locations to be determined. Opportunities for basic and clinical research are available for interested candidates. Preference will be given to candidates with fellowship training in genitourinary reconstructive surgery.

OPPORTUNITY HIGHLIGHTS
  • Patient Diversity – Manage a high volume of patients with urinary incontinence, urethral strictures, ureteral strictures, as well as patients who need post radiation or post traumatic injury reconstruction.
  • University of Maryland is home to the renowned R Adams Cowley Shock Trauma Center — the nation’s first integrated trauma hospital and a globally recognized leader in complex trauma, reconstructive surgery, and multidisciplinary critical care.
  • Faculty benefit from collaboration within one of the country’s highest-volume Level I trauma systems, offering exceptional exposure to complex genitourinary reconstruction, pelvic trauma, urethral injury, and challenging referral cases.
  • Collaborate with Urology residents to contribute to a positive learning experience.
  • Collaborate with a committed clinical team, including PAs and RNs, to provide top-notch patient care.
  • Receive academic rank at Assistant or Associate Professor with a schedule to support research, teaching, and clinical work.
